The LDTC2-2E Wavelength Laser Diode Temperature Controller MPL-5000 is a sophisticated and precision-engineered device, designed to provide optimal temperature control for wavelength laser diodes in various applications. This controller offers a high level of accuracy and reliability, making it an essential tool for researchers, scientists, and engineers working with laser diodes.
The MPL-5000 is a 2-channel temperature controller, designed to manage the temperature of two separate laser diodes simultaneously. Each channel supports a wide range of operating temperatures, from -50 C to 200 C, ensuring compatibility with a broad array of laser diode types.
The controller features a user-friendly interface, with an LCD display that clearly shows the temperature for each channel, along with the set point, actual power, and other essential parameters. The intuitive menu system allows for easy configuration, including setting temperature set points, alarm limits, and other operational parameters.
The MPL-5000 employs advanced PID control algorithms to maintain the desired temperature with high precision. It also includes a built-in power supply, providing a stable DC voltage and current to the laser diodes, ensuring consistent performance.
Safety is a key consideration in the design of the MPL-5000. The controller includes over-temperature protection, over-voltage protection, and short-circuit protection, helping to prevent damage to the laser diodes and ensuring the safety of the user.
